Port Razer
Creature — Orc Pirate
Whenever this creature deals combat damage to a player, untap each creature you control. After this phase, there is an additional combat phase.
This creature can't attack a player it has already attacked this turn.

Port Razer turns a single swing into a full extra combat for every opponent you connect with — one hit per player means three extra combats in a four-player pod. The five-mana body is acceptable, but the real cost is that it does nothing without evasion or a wide board; pair it with Helm of the Host or slot it into Admiral Brass, Unsinkable and the payoff is immediately game-ending.
Best Commanders
Commanders with the highest synergy

Admiral Brass, Unsinkable
Admiral Brass, Unsinkable makes Port Razer a near-auto-include: Brass reanimates pirates that die in combat, and Port Razer's extra combats mean more attacks, more deaths, more reanimation triggers until the table is out of blockers.

Admiral Beckett Brass
Admiral Beckett Brass rewards hitting three opponents with stealing permanents, and Port Razer stacks extra combats so you can trigger that steal condition multiple times in a single turn.

Raph & Mikey, Troublemakers
Raph & Mikey, Troublemakers care about dealing combat damage repeatedly, and Port Razer supplies the additional combat steps needed to stack those triggers well beyond what a single attack phase offers.

Delina, Wild Mage
Delina, Wild Mage creates temporary creature copies on hit, and Port Razer's extra combats let Delina roll for more copies each step — the two together form a self-reinforcing loop that can spiral out of control quickly.


Breeches, Brazen Plunderer // Malcolm, Keen-Eyed Navigator
Breeches, Brazen Plunderer // Malcolm, Keen-Eyed Navigator converts combat damage into treasure and opponent card theft, and Port Razer multiplies how many times those triggers fire in a single turn.

Port Razer is a Commander card through and through — the multi-opponent clause is essentially dead text in any one-on-one format, and five mana is too slow for Legacy or Vintage without a payoff that scales to those tables. In Commander, though, the design shines: each opponent you connect with grants a separate extra combat, so a single unblocked swing in a four-player pod generates three additional attack phases. Oathbreaker is legal but the one-on-one structure cuts the ceiling dramatically. Stick to Commander.
